OhmniLabs Launches First Open Telepresence Robotics Platform


SANTA CLARA, Calif., May 24, 2018 /PRNewswire/ -- OhmniLabs (https://ohmnilabs.com/), a Silicon Valley-based robotics company, today announces the first open telepresence robotics platform, called the Ohmni DevKit, to enable faster, cheaper, and easier development of custom robotics applications built on top of telepresence.

The new Ohmni DevKit is based on the affordable, production-grade Ohmni telepresence robot and is designed for maximum hardware and software extensibility.  Any developer can plug in custom hardware (such as Arduino-based electronics, servos, lights), as well as their own USB devices. The newly launched in-call Ohmni API makes it easy to remotely control these devices, with no networking, signaling, or cloud development required. With Ohmni coding framework for robotics, developers can build rich, interactive HTML5/CSS/JS overlays to Ohmni's browser-based calls that can send and receive commands in real time with Ohmni and your custom devices. 

Ohmni DevKit includes:

  • 1x Ohmni Dev Edition - ROS dev libraries and modules preinstalled
  • 3D printed mounting bracket kit - attach your devices anywhere on Ohmni
  • Arduino-based flashlight sample module and reference design
  • Arduino power + serial adapter kit
  • Arduino libraries and reference code for packet bus

Advantages of new Ohmni DevKit:

  • Easy to extend Ohmni's browser telepresence UI with your own custom overlays
  • No need for network development, infrastructure, or signaling 
  • Leverage Ohmni's hardware accelerated HD audio/video codecs
  • Full ROS support
  • Plug and play support for 3rd party electronics and hardware, i.e. Arduino
  • Ability to add your own USB devices, such as depth cameras
  • Ohmni OS built on top of open frameworks like Android 7.1
  • Modifiable, standard Linux kernel makes it easy to add device support
  • Easy to build and deploy using Ohmni cloud robotics development framework
  • Customizable height between 4'8" and 4' tall for natural interaction

The Ohmni DevKit will start at $2,500 with additional modules and accessories being added over the coming months. For more information, visit: www.ohmnilabs.com/developer.html
